Analysis
In 2009, other long-term inflows, net in Sudan stood at 0 BoP, current US$.
The figure is down 100.0% over ten years.
Over the whole period, other long-term inflows, net in Sudan peaked at 473.70 million BoP, current US$ in 1995 and was at its lowest, -827.45 million BoP, current US$, in 1982.
That places Sudan 7th out of 50 countries with data for 2009, putting it in the top qu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

About this data
Other long-term capital comprises the difference between long-term capital, as defined for total long-term capital: excluding reserves and LCFAR, and the similar item reported in IMF balance of payments statistics. Data are in current U.S. dollars.
